Yuebin Lv is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Physiology and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is. According to data from OpenAlex, Yuebin Lv has authored 80 papers receiving a total of 2.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 24 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 22 papers in Physiology and 20 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is. Recurrent topics in Yuebin Lv's work include Nutrition and Health in Aging (19 papers), Nutritional Studies and Diet (17 papers) and Health disparities and outcomes (16 papers). Yuebin Lv is often cited by papers focused on Nutrition and Health in Aging (19 papers), Nutritional Studies and Diet (17 papers) and Health disparities and outcomes (16 papers). Yuebin Lv coll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Hong Kong. Yuebin Lv's co-authors include Xiaoming Shi, Zhaoxue Yin, Virginia B. Kraus, Yi Zeng, Chen Mao, John S. Ji, Xiang Gao, Xiao‐Ming Shi, Melanie Sereny Brasher and Anna Zhu and has published in prestigious journals such as The Lancet, Environmental Science & Technology and American Journal of Clinical Nutrition.
